Metal siding replacement services involve removing old or damaged siding and installing new metal panels to improve both the appearance and durability of a property’s exterior. This process typically starts with a thorough assessment of the existing siding to identify issues such as rust, warping, or extensive damage. Once the old material is carefully removed, skilled contractors install high-quality metal panels that can withstand harsh weather conditions, resist pests, and require minimal maintenance. Proper installation ensures the siding functions effectively as a protective barrier, helping to extend the lifespan of the building’s exterior.

This service helps address a variety of common problems that can compromise the integrity and appearance of a property. For homeowners dealing with rotting wood, cracked or fading siding, or persistent pest issues, metal siding provides a durable and low-maintenance alternative. It also offers enhanced resistance to moisture and temperature fluctuations, reducing the likelihood of water infiltration and related damage. Replacing worn or damaged siding with metal can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and sealing gaps that allow drafts or heat loss.

The overview below groups typical Metal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kent,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or metal siding repairs in Kent, WA, range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and material type.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of metal siding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ements can approach $4,000 or more, but most projects stay within the mid-range.

Full Siding Replacement - Complete metal siding replacement for a standard home often costs between $5,000 and $12,000. Larger or more intricate projects can exceed $15,000, though many fall into the middle of this range.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or custom metal siding installations can reach $20,000 or higher. These projects are less common and typically involve unique design elements or extensive work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of metal siding replacement? Metal siding replacement can enhance the durability and appearance of a building, offering increased resistance to weather and reducing maintenance needs.

How do I know if my building needs new metal siding? Signs include visible rust, warping, dents, or fading, which indicate that the existing siding may need to be replaced.

What types of metal siding are available for replacement? Common options include aluminum, steel, and copper siding, each offering different aesthetics and performance features.

Can metal siding replacement improve energy efficiency? Yes, replacing old siding with modern metal options can help improve insulation and reduce energy costs.
